Post Changing from dual-tip exhaust to quad-tip

This only applies to cars that came without dual-mode exhaust (NPP). My car was supposed to have NPP but it didn't happen (long story). So, ever since I took delivery, I have been exploring ways to get quad-tips and adjustable exhaust. Looks like the only way to get adjustable sound is to add electric cut-outs. I have been in touch with the aftermarket (Borla, SW, Kooks) and their NPP replacement systems require the car to have been built with NPP. They are making exhaust with the valves but not the valve controllers.

That being considered, I have decided to just change the rear facia and the exhaust to quad-tip. That will give me the look and sound I want.

Borla makes two quad-tip systems that don't have NPP valves. 11920 & 11921
http://www.borla.com/chevy-2016-camaro-exhaust-systems/

Kooks makes two systems with either black or polished quad-tips. One eliminates the muffler completely and the other has a muffler like the Borla systems. Unfortunately no photos are available for the Kooks systems. First 4 Kooks systems are the ones I am referring to: https://www.lmperformance.com/car.as...=2016&b=0&su=Y

These systems are the company's dual-mode (NPP) exhaust without the valves. So you cannot adjust the sound like a NPP system can.

They can be used on cars with NPP if the owner wants to bypass the valves (don't know why anyone would want to do that). Or they can be installed on cars without NPP as long as the rear facia is changed.

Price for the quad-tip facia: List was $233 (Part # 23404791). Facia may need to be painted. Parts catalog says paint to match but I'm hoping it comes with a matte finish like the dual exhaust facia that came on my car.
Edit: Facia came smooth black. Off to the paint shop for gloss black treatment.
